, the administration of the ordinances referenced in Section 2.1 B. <br /> Subject to the remainder of this Section. Chapel Hill shall <br /> administer the referenced ordinances just as if the land were <br /> located within the Town's planning jurisdiction. Administration <br /> shall include but not be limited to the following: <br /> 1. Receipt and processing of applications;. <br /> 2. Issuance of any required permits and certificates; <br /> 3. Review and approval of required site/construction plans; <br /> 4. Conducting necessary site/building inspections; <br /> ' 5. Enforcement of all standards; <br /> 6. ' Any other acts or things necessary to administer <br /> the Ordinances;, <br /> and shall be carried out in manner so as to insure that a <br /> developer complies with all applicable ordinance requirements and <br /> the terms and conditions of any permit issued by Chapel Hill. <br /> Chapel Hill may also charge fees for processing of applications, <br /> conducting site/construction plan reviews and carrying out <br /> site/building inspections in accordance with fee schedules <br /> applicable within it's extraterritorial planning jurisdiction. <br /> B. To the extent possible, the timetables <br /> of the County and Town shall provide for simultaneous review to <br /> expedite application processing; provided, however , the Town may <br /> not vote to issue or deny .a permit until it has received the <br /> recommendations of Orange County or until the expiration of <br /> forty-five (45) days after Orange County has received the <br /> application, whichever comes first. <br /> Section 2.4 Permit Administration in the Rural Buffer <br /> A. Except as otherwise provided in Section 2.6 and <br /> the remaining provisions of this Section. Orange County shall <br /> perform all functions related to the administration of the <br /> ordinances referenced in Section 2.2 in the same manner as if the <br /> land were located outside the Joint Planning Area. <br /> B. Whenever Orange County receives an application for a <br /> development permit relating to , land located within the CHJDA <br /> Rural Buffer, it shall forward copies at the application 1...Q - <br /> Chapel Hill fox review. The County shall establish timetables to <br /> insure that Chapel Hill has An opportunity, ta snake <br /> • rec.m - tda i. , xecfaxdinq such applications within the framework <br /> at the Town's regularly scheduled meeting dates. To the extent <br /> possible, the timetables of the Town and County shall provide for <br /> simultaneous review ta expedite application processing:. <br /> provided, howeverl , Orange County may not vote to issue or deny a <br /> permit until it has received the recommendations of Chapel Hill <br /> or until the expiration of forty-five (45) days after Chapel Hill <br /> has received the application, whichever occurs first. <br />
